Cigar-bar endorsement clears committee despite health concerns; amendment defining 'premium cigar' fails
Summary
Senate Bill 150 to create a cigar-bar endorsement passed out of the Business, Labor and Economic Affairs Committee 6–5 after debate over worker exposure and definitions of 'premium cigars'; a proposed amendment that would have modified humidor size and other definitions failed 4–7.
Senate Bill 150, which would create a cigar‑bar alcoholic-beverage endorsement, drew heated debate in the Senate Business, Labor and Economic Affairs Committee over indoor-air quality and employee safety before passing on a narrow 6–5 roll-call vote.
